Safe Meta-Reinforcement Learning via Information Space Reachability

Meta-reinforcement learning (meta-RL) enables agents to adapt to unseen tasks with limited experience. Despite its promise, the application of meta-RL in real-world tasks is hindered by safety requirements, which have been underexplored in prior work. In this paper, we propose a safe meta-RL framework that explicitly accounts for safety during adaptation. Our key insight is to reason about safety in the information space, which captures both the physical state and the agent's belief over the underlying task. Within this space, we introduce a safety value function that measures the probability of the agent avoiding unsafe regions indefinitely. We show that this function satisfies a self-consistency condition and a Bellman equation, which make it learnable via meta-RL. Based on this formulation, we develop a safe meta-RL algorithm that learns the safety value function and leverages it for safety filtering and constrained policy optimization. Experiments on meta-RL benchmarks demonstrate the effectiveness of the proposed method.
